When children start to worry, they get themselves into a worry cycle where their flight-fright-freeze-appease part of their brain starts up (not by choice mind you but as a reaction to something). Once that worry cycle gets spinning, it can be a huge challenge to stop. That's why we need strategies that help our children interrupt the worry cycle and get on the peace cycle instead.
